Abstract

The electronic device includes a thin-film transistor ( 10 ) with an active layer ( 5 ) that comprises an organic semiconductor material and a carrier material that is free of charge camera. The carrier material has a conductivity below 10 −6 S/cm and is preferably electrically insulating. The thin-film transistor ( 10 ) has a mobility that is comparable to that of a transistor with an active layer that consists of an organic semiconductor material. Preferably, the organic semiconductor material is an oligomer. The composition used to apply the active layer may contain a photosensitive component. Using such a composition, the active layer can be relief-structured, thereby preventing any leakage current between neighboring transistors in the electronic device.

Claims (4)

1. An electronic device equipped with a thin-film transistor ( 10 ) comprising a first electrode layer ( 2 ) with a source electrode ( 21 ) and a drain electrode ( 22 ), an active layer ( 5 ) comprising an organic semiconductor, an intermediate layer ( 4 ) comprising dielectric material, and a second electrode layer ( 3 ) comprising a gate electrode ( 24 ), characterized in that the active layer ( 5 ) comprises an organic carrier material that is free of charge carrier and mixed with the organic semiconductor.

2. An electronic device as claimed in claim 1 , characterized in that the active layer ( 5 ) is patterned in accordance with a desired pattern so as to form a relief structure.

3. An electronic device as claimed in claim 1 , characterized in that the organic semiconductor is an oligothiophene.

4. An electronic device as claimed in claim 1 , characterized in that the organic semiconductor is pentacene.
